Splet02. dec. 2024 · Move slowly and smoothly into your downswing. As you do this, use your trail hand to pull the lead arm downwards; avoid any tendency for it to move out towards the ball. You should feel your upper arm brush down the front of your shirt. As a check, your lead arm should point out across the line as it reaches parallel with the ground. SpletTo correct this you need to focus on moving forward onto your front foot sooner through impact. Try finishing with your chest leaning outside your front foot for a while as opposed to leaning back (a reverse C finish). Don't make the mistake of keeping your head back too long. It needs to come forward. Splet15. apr. 2013 · As your first move down from the top, get your weight moving to your front foot. This little forward bump will drop your hands and arms to the inside, setting up a powerful move through the ball....
